POSITION CLASSIFICATION DESCRIPTION


Position Classification Title: Custodial Worker
Position Classification Code: K4002
Job Family: Grounds and Facilities
Pay Level: 01
Exempt Status: Non-exempt
This description is intended to describe the general nature of the work being performed. It is not intended to be a complete list of specific duties of any particular position. Duties, responsibilities and bargaining unit eligibility may vary based on the specific tasks assigned to the position.
Purpose of Classification:
Under direct supervision, responsible for the cleaning and custodial care of buildings and working areas. Primary responsibility is for the use of proper methods and materials in cleaning and otherwise caring for building areas. Follows a well established routine.
Standard Duties:
Sweeps, mops, polishes and performs restorative/interim floor and carpet maintenance in rooms and halls. Dusts and/or polishes furniture, blinds and equipment. Empties trash receptacles and bags trash for proper disposal. Cleans restrooms and fills dispensers. Vacuums, spot cleans rugs, carpets, and furniture. Reports malfunctions of bathroom fixtures, light fixtures and/or damages to the interior of buildings i.e. walls, floors, ceilings, windows, furnishings, doors, locks, bathroom dispensers, graffiti etc. to supervisor. Stocks area with appropriate supplies. Locks and unlocks doors as directed. Initiates work orders for repair/maintenance. Moves furniture, equipment or fixtures as required. Washes dishes or utensils as required. May replace light bulbs. May be required to move or lift heavy items. Performs duties as assigned.
Knowledge, Skills and Abilities:
Knowledge of cleaning equipment, products, techniques and standards.
Skill in using cleaning products and equipment.
The ability to bend, stretch, twist, or reach with your body, arms, and/or legs. Be able to read and write. Be able to use a computer to fill out time cards electronically. Be able to lift or move heavy items.
